hep.aida.web.taglib
Interface PlotSetTag

All Superinterfaces:
PlotterTag, StyleProvider
All Known Implementing Classes:
PlotSetTagImpl, PlotSetTagSupport

public interface PlotSetTag
extends PlotterTag

A top level tag which generates an image containing one or more plots.

Author:
The AIDA Team @ SLAC

Field Summary
 
Fields inherited from interface hep.aida.web.taglib.StyleProvider
plotterStyle
 
Method Summary
 void setId(java.lang.String id)
          The id for the browsing when multiple plotSet tags are present in a page.
 void setLayout(java.lang.String layout)
          The layout of the plot page.
 void setMaxplots(int maxplots)
          The maximum number of plots in a page.
 void setNplots(int nPlots)
          Total number of plots to browse.
 void setPlots(java.lang.Object plots)
          Set objects to plot.
 void setStatusvar(java.lang.String var)
          Set the name of the variable that is going to keep the information about the current status of the PlotSetTag processing.
 
Methods inherited from interface hep.aida.web.taglib.PlotterTag
setAllowDownload, setCreateImageMap, setFormat, setHeight, setName, setNx, setNy, setVar, setWidth
 
Methods inherited from interface hep.aida.web.taglib.StyleProvider
getStyle, getStyle
 

Method Detail

setPlots

void setPlots(java.lang.Object plots)
Set objects to plot. Can be an array of plottable objects, a single plottable object, or a String name that refferes to such object. It is required if "nplots" attribute is not set.


setNplots

void setNplots(int nPlots)
Total number of plots to browse. It is required if "plots" attribute is not set.


setMaxplots

void setMaxplots(int maxplots)
The maximum number of plots in a page.


setStatusvar

void setStatusvar(java.lang.String var)
Set the name of the variable that is going to keep the information about the current status of the PlotSetTag processing.


setId

void setId(java.lang.String id)
The id for the browsing when multiple plotSet tags are present in a page.


setLayout

void setLayout(java.lang.String layout)
The layout of the plot page. Must be in a form of "nHxnW", "3x4" means 3 plots in Height direction, 4 plots in Width direction.



Copyright 2000-2007 FreeHEP. All Rights Reserved.